Output fab8148d26f0b32fa4ec00bb6da3977d035edd5922bde01fdf4f613043eb22c9:0

value
4791441
script pubkey
OP_HASH160 OP_PUSHBYTES_20 def5837fa4d98fb9ae9a5ffc6caff49bc07e53de OP_EQUAL
address
3N1v3idzK3aqTumTUZogcKuQAD5Gdv7NGa
transaction
fab8148d26f0b32fa4ec00bb6da3977d035edd5922bde01fdf4f613043eb22c9
confirmations
539158
spent
true